はじめに
Google ReCaptchaは、Webアプリケーションをスパム、ボット、悪用から保護するための重要なサービスです。Reactでは、各バージョンに特化したライブラリを使用して簡単に実装できます。このドキュメントは、 Andrés Hernández.
ReCaptcha V2について学ぶこと
- フォームに「私はロボットではありません」チェックボックスコンポーネントを統合する方法。
- 画像による視覚的チャレンジの実装。
- 基本設定とトークンの検証。
- お問い合わせフォームを保護する実例。
- google-react-recaptcha-v2 パッケージの使用。
ReCaptcha V3について学ぶこと
- ライブラリの初期インストールと設定。
- useRecaptcha フックとその設定オプションの使用。
- TypeScript とそのすべてのインターフェースでの実装。
- 高度な設定:Trusted Types、CSP、および多言語。
- 完全な API:サービス、ユーティリティ、および事前定義された定数。
- 一般的なエラーの処理と回復戦略。
- 実例:お問い合わせフォーム、チェックアウト、分析。